Output 270a62b86a989993f94c7beeedb37b49dac1d3cf82075a0c81da7ac0098752c0:0

value
344289885
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95b4095971bc259e1c77b83b00596c00c778bea OP_EQUALVERIFY OP_CHECKSIG
address
1Hu5KotNPmABUKXWKXN9ydTiEYuABggPtY
transaction
270a62b86a989993f94c7beeedb37b49dac1d3cf82075a0c81da7ac0098752c0
spent
true